Sepp Kuss (born September 13, 1994) is an American professional cyclist from Durango, Colorado who rides for UCI WorldTeam Visma–Lease a Bike.[8] A talented climber, Kuss won the 2023 Vuelta a España, the first American to do so since Chris Horner in 2013. He has also won individual stages at the Tour de France and Vuelta a España.
